UV nail lamps emit ultraviolet (UV) and near-visible light to cure photoreactive gel polishes. They are not suitable for traditional air-dry nail polishes. A lamp may seem to work if the surface feels hard, but this does not guarantee complete curing of the gel. The true effectiveness depends on factors such as the lamp’s specific wavelength spectrum, the amount of light (irradiance) reaching the nail, exposure duration, coverage across the entire hand, and the gel’s formulation, color, thickness, and instructions. Special care is needed for thumbs, edges, dark shades, builder gels, extensions, and unfamiliar formulas.
Reliable products are supported by model-specific testing rather than generic claims. Look for independent laboratory reports compliant with ISO/IEC 17025 that detail the exact product, recommended operating distance, wavelength spectrum, irradiance maps, timer settings, and tested gel systems. These reports should demonstrate complete curing under specified conditions, including relevant layer thicknesses and nail positions. Compatibility lists from gel manufacturers and specific curing instructions are more informative than vague statements like “works with all gels.” Remember, electrical wattage ratings such as 30W, 54W, 80W, 120W, or 180W do not directly indicate the effective curing dose or performance, as actual UV output varies.
For safety, seek an IEC/EN 62471 photobiological safety report for the exact model and operating distance, using recognized risk assessment methods such as ANSI/IES RP-27. Features like timers, motion sensors, or low-heat modes can help control exposure but cannot replace actual measured data. The relevant wavelengths include 365 nm (UVA) and 405 nm (near-visible violet). The term “non-ultraviolet” for curing wavelengths is misleading. Low-heat modes are beneficial only if their temperature control and curing efficacy are validated through testing.
Electrical safety claims should be traceable to specific lamps and adapters through recognized testing laboratories like UL Product iQ, Intertek’s ETL, or CSA Group. Certification marks such as CE, RoHS, or general FCC declarations are not substitute for U.S. safety listings. For cordless units, check battery chemistry, compliance with IEC 62133-2 and UN 38.3 standards, proper charging instructions, and available U.S. recycling options.
Choose a device with a stable, easy-to-clean opening. Removable bases facilitate pedicures and cleaning, but intricate designs might be harder to maintain. A written warranty, clear policies for replacement parts, repair options, and take-back programs indicate longer service life. Be cautious of inconsistent specifications such as bead counts, wattages, sizes, warranty terms, or battery details.
Overall, most available models lack independent, comprehensive proof of correct spectrum, safe exposure levels, complete curing, temperature management, and U.S. safety certification for the exact product. Therefore, they are best suited for experienced adults familiar with compatible gel instructions, applying thin layers carefully to avoid uncured gel on skin. Individuals with allergies to acrylates or methacrylates, unexplained skin issues, photosensitivity, or previous adverse reactions should avoid relying on broad claims of compatibility. Several reviews recommend against use by children or professional users without documented process control. Discontinue use if experiencing unusual heat, rash, itching, swelling, pain, nail lifting, or ongoing irritation. Also, do not dispose of rechargeable devices in household trash or curbside recycling at end-of-life.

Published studies on UV nail lamps show that these devices generally emit mostly UVA radiation. However, the actual output and safe exposure levels can vary significantly between different models. This particular product lacks publicly available information on its specific light spectrum or hand-exposure testing, so its UV dose cannot be accurately determined based solely on its 80 W power rating or LED count. Additionally, dermatological research indicates that uncured acrylate and methacrylate nail products are associated with allergic contact dermatitis. To reduce risks, it is important to prevent gel from touching the skin and to ensure complete curing of the gel as per the manufacturer's instructions. This cordless nail lamp contains a rechargeable battery, with one marketplace report citing the use of three lithium-ion cells. There is no publicly available label specifying the battery chemistry, no UN 38.3 safety testing summary, program for replacing batteries, or brand take-back scheme identified. The EPA recommends disposing of lithium-ion batteries and devices containing them through dedicated collection programs rather than household trash or curbside recycling. No U.S. product recalls related to this item have been found through CPSC sources.

UV nail lamps primarily emit UVA radiation, and the level of exposure can vary significantly depending on the specific lamp and how it is used. Research on other types of lamps indicates that typical manicure procedures generally pose a low estimated risk; however, some lamps have exceeded safety exposure limits. The existing evidence does not confirm the UV output levels of this particular product. The instructions provided recommend avoiding direct eye exposure but do not specify model-specific UV dose information or guidance on hand protection. Incomplete curing can leave behind sensitizing acrylate monomers in gel products. To minimize this risk, it's important to apply the gel in thin layers, prevent the gel from touching the skin, and use the recommended lamp and curing time specified by the manufacturer. The product is equipped with rechargeable lithium-polymer batteries, but there are no specific instructions for removal, recycling, or returning the batteries. According to EPA guidance, lithium-ion batteries and devices containing them should not be disposed of in household trash or curbside recycling due to the risk of fire, and should instead be taken to designated battery or electronic waste collection facilities.
